Home
last modified time | relevance | path

Searched refs:XMM2 (Results 1 – 25 of 26) sorted by relevance

12

/external/mesa3d/src/mesa/x86/
Dsse_normal.S77 MOVSS ( M(5), XMM2 ) /* m5 */
78 UNPCKLPS( XMM2, XMM1 ) /* m5 | m0 */
86 MOVLPS ( S(0), XMM2 ) /* uy | ux */
87 MULPS ( XMM1, XMM2 ) /* uy*m5*scale | ux*m0*scale */
88 MOVLPS ( XMM2, D(0) ) /* ->D(1) | D(0) */
90 MOVSS ( S(2), XMM2 ) /* uz */
91 MULSS ( XMM0, XMM2 ) /* uz*m10*scale */
92 MOVSS ( XMM2, D(2) ) /* ->D(2) */
147 MOVSS ( M(5), XMM2 ) /* m5 */
148 UNPCKLPS( XMM2, XMM1 ) /* m5 | m1 */
[all …]
Dsse_xform1.S82 MOVSS( S(0), XMM2 ) /* ox */
83 SHUFPS( CONST(0x0), XMM2, XMM2 ) /* ox | ox | ox | ox */
84 MULPS( XMM0, XMM2 ) /* ox*m3 | ox*m2 | ox*m1 | ox*m0 */
85 ADDPS( XMM1, XMM2 ) /* + | + | + | + */
86 MOVUPS( XMM2, D(0) )
188 MOVSS( M(13), XMM2 ) /* m13 */
198 MOVSS( XMM2, D(1) )
249 MOVSS( M(14), XMM2 ) /* m14 */
256 MOVSS( XMM2, D(2) ) /* m14->D(2) */
310 MOVSS( S(0), XMM2 ) /* ox */
[all …]
Dsse_xform3.S79 MOVAPS ( REGOFF(32, EDX), XMM2 ) /* m8 | m9 | m10 | m11 */
94 MULPS ( XMM2, XMM6 ) /* m11*oz | m10*oz | m9*oz | m8*oz */
205 MOVSS ( M(5), XMM2 ) /* - | - | - | m5 */
206 UNPCKLPS ( XMM2, XMM1 ) /* - | - | m5 | m0 */
207 MOVLPS ( M(12), XMM2 ) /* - | - | m13 | m12 */
216 ADDPS ( XMM2, XMM0 ) /* - | - | +m13 | +m12 */
270 MOVSS ( M(5), XMM2 ) /* - | - | - | m5 */
271 UNPCKLPS ( XMM2, XMM1 ) /* - | - | m5 | m0 */
272 MOVLPS ( M(8), XMM2 ) /* - | - | m9 | m8 */
283 MULPS ( XMM2, XMM5 ) /* oz*m9 | oz*m8 */
[all …]
Dsse_xform2.S78 MOVAPS( M(12), XMM2 ) /* m15 | m14 | m13 | m12 */
90 ADDPS( XMM2, XMM3 )
193 MOVSS ( M(5), XMM2 ) /* - | - | - | m5 */
194 UNPCKLPS ( XMM2, XMM1 ) /* - | - | m5 | m0 */
195 MOVLPS ( M(12), XMM2 ) /* - | - | m13 | m12 */
202 ADDPS ( XMM2, XMM0 ) /* - | - | +m13 | +m12 */
252 MOVSS ( M(5), XMM2 ) /* - | - | - | m5 */
253 UNPCKLPS ( XMM2, XMM1 ) /* - | - | m5 | m0 */
312 MOVLPS( M(12), XMM2 ) /* m13 | m12 */
325 ADDPS( XMM2, XMM3 )
[all …]
Dsse_xform4.S86 MOVSS( SRC(2), XMM2 ) /* oz */
87 SHUFPS( CONST(0x0), XMM2, XMM2 ) /* oz | oz | oz | oz */
88 MULPS( XMM6, XMM2 ) /* oz*m11 | oz*m10 | oz*m9 | oz*m8 */
95 ADDPS( XMM2, XMM0 ) /* ox*m3+oy*m7+oz*m11 | ... */
145 MOVAPS( MAT(8), XMM2 ) /* m11 | m10 | m9 | m8 */
160 MULPS( XMM2, XMM6 ) /* oz*m11 | oz*m10 | oz*m9 | oz*m8 */
Dassyntax.h226 #define XMM2 %xmm2 macro
/external/llvm/lib/Target/X86/
DX86CallingConv.td42 // Vector types are returned in XMM0 and XMM1, when they fit. XMM2 and XMM3
46 CCAssignToReg<[XMM0,XMM1,XMM2,XMM3]>>,
76 CCIfType<[f32, f64], CCAssignToReg<[XMM0,XMM1,XMM2]>>>>,
87 CCIfType<[f32], CCIfSubtarget<"hasSSE2()", CCAssignToReg<[XMM0,XMM1,XMM2]>>>,
88 CCIfType<[f64], CCIfSubtarget<"hasSSE2()", CCAssignToReg<[XMM0,XMM1,XMM2]>>>,
103 CCAssignToReg<[XMM0,XMM1,XMM2,XMM3]>>,
131 CCAssignToReg<[XMM0,XMM1,XMM2,XMM3]>>,
264 CCAssignToReg<[XMM0, XMM1, XMM2, XMM3, XMM4, XMM5, XMM6, XMM7]>>>,
327 [XMM0, XMM1, XMM2, XMM3]>>,
333 [XMM1, XMM2, XMM3]>>>>,
[all …]
DREADME-SSE.txt187 %XMM2 = MOVAPSrr %XMM0
188 SHUFPSrr %XMM2<def&use>, %XMM2, 0
DX86RegisterInfo.td174 def XMM2: X86Reg<"xmm2", 2>, DwarfRegNum<[19, 23, 23]>;
DX86FastISel.cpp2747 X86::XMM0, X86::XMM1, X86::XMM2, X86::XMM3, in fastLowerArguments()
3041 X86::XMM0, X86::XMM1, X86::XMM2, X86::XMM3, in fastLowerCall()
DX86InstrCompiler.td419 XMM0, XMM1, XMM2, XMM3, XMM4, XMM5, XMM6, XMM7,
439 XMM0, XMM1, XMM2, XMM3, XMM4, XMM5, XMM6, XMM7,
/external/llvm/test/CodeGen/X86/
Dstackmap-liveness.ll47 ; LiveOut Entry 1: %YMM2 (16 bytes) --> %XMM2
94 ; LiveOut Entry 5: %YMM2 (16 bytes) --> %XMM2
126 ; LiveOut Entry 2: %YMM2 (16 bytes) --> %XMM2
163 ; LiveOut Entry 2: %YMM2 (16 bytes) --> %XMM2
Dbreak-false-dep.ll78 ; SSE: xorps [[XMM2:%xmm[0-9]+]]
79 ; SSE: , [[XMM2]]
80 ; SSE: cvtsi2ssl %{{.*}}, [[XMM2]]
Dghc-cc64.ll17 @f2 = external global float ; assigned to register: XMM2
/external/llvm/test/TableGen/
Dcast.td48 def XMM2: Register<"xmm2">;
64 [XMM0, XMM1, XMM2, XMM3, XMM4, XMM5, XMM6, XMM7,
DSlice.td42 def XMM2: Register<"xmm2">;
58 [XMM0, XMM1, XMM2, XMM3, XMM4, XMM5, XMM6, XMM7,
DTargetInstrSpec.td49 def XMM2: Register<"xmm2">;
65 [XMM0, XMM1, XMM2, XMM3, XMM4, XMM5, XMM6, XMM7,
DMultiPat.td52 def XMM2: Register<"xmm2">;
68 [XMM0, XMM1, XMM2, XMM3, XMM4, XMM5, XMM6, XMM7,
/external/llvm/test/MC/X86/
Dintel-syntax-encoding.s65 cmpltps XMM2, XMM1
Dintel-syntax.s73 vshufpd XMM0, XMM1, XMM2, 1
/external/llvm/lib/Target/X86/Disassembler/
DX86DisassemblerDecoder.h219 ENTRY(XMM2) \
/external/valgrind/memcheck/
Dmc_machine.c716 if (o >= GOF(XMM2) && o+sz <= GOF(XMM2)+SZB(XMM2)) return GOF(XMM2); in get_otrack_shadow_offset_wrk()
/external/llvm/docs/TableGen/
Dindex.rst69 XMM0, XMM1, XMM10, XMM11, XMM12, XMM13, XMM14, XMM15, XMM2, XMM3, XMM4, XMM5,
DLangIntro.rst544 XMM0, XMM1, XMM2, XMM3, XMM4, XMM5, XMM6, XMM7, EFLAGS] in {
/external/libvpx/libvpx/vp8/common/x86/
Dloopfilter_sse2.asm699 movdqa [rsp+_t0], xmm2 ; save to free XMM2

12